Latest Devices
The DROID RAZR is thin, having only a 7.1mm thick body. Other key features include a 4.3-inch Super AMOLED qHD display, 1.2GHz dual-core processor, 8-megapixel camera, 1080p HD video capture, front-facing "HD" camera, 16GB built-in storage, 16GB microSD card, 1GB RAM, 1,780mAh battery, Verizon 4G LTE, Android 2.3.5 (Gingerbread) and Motorola's custom UI.
The Motorola Milestone Plus offers Google Android 2.2, 8GB of internal memory space, a 3.1" HVGA display, Adobe Flash 10, a 1GHz processory, and is World Phone capable.

The Motorola Droid 4 offers Android 2.3 (Gingerbread) and can be updated to Android 4.0 (Ice Cream Sandwich) later on. Other features include a physical QWERTY keyboard, 4" qHD display, mobile hotspot, 1.2GHz dual-core processor, 1GB RAM, 8MP camera and 1080p HD video capture.
The Motorola DROID RAZR MAXX is an Android 2.3.5 (Gingerbread) smartphone coming in a 8.99mm thin. The device can be upgraded the Android 4.0 (Ice Cream Sandwich) later down the line. Key features include a dual-core 1.2GHz processor, mobile hotspot, WiFi, data tethering, Swype technology, and a 8MP camera.
The Droid Xyboard 10.1 includes a 1.2GHz dual-core processor, 16GB RAM, 5MP camera, 1.3MP front-facing camera, mobile hotspot, 4G LTE capable device, and a Dijit™ app that allows the tablet to work as a universal remote control. It comes loaded with Android 3.2 (Honeycomb) with upgrades to 4.0 (Ice Cream Sandwich) planned.

The Droid Xyboard 8.2 includes a 1.2GHz dual-core processor, 16GB RAM, 5MP camera, 1.3MP front-facing camera, mobile hotspot, 4G LTE capable device, and a Dijit™ app that allows the tablet to work as a universal remote control. It comes loaded with Android 3.2 (Honeycomb) with upgrades to 4.0 (Ice Cream Sandwich) planned.
